Originally Posted by zoober
when i take off the oil cap it cuts out
Thats good it means your breather system is not blocked, and crank case pressure is being fed back into the metering head like its suposed to.
cris4rst I think your a bit confused mate!? Unless he is EFi the car should cut out if you remove the oil filler cap because that creates a giant air leak preventing the flap in the metering head from being sucked down and giving the car any fuel!

If you whip the oil filler cap off and put your hand over it you should feel suction, if you feel pressure then yeah that indicates possible heavy piston ring/Bore wear etc...
